> I agree with Dien,
> Long term is all I play and I have stocks
> that have grown ten fold in jsut 2 years.
> My method is research.
> 1 - The company
> 2 - their history
> 3 - the people running the comany
> 4 - the history of the people running the
> company
> 5 - the market.
> I never listen to market predictions - I
> research and make my own judgement call!
> I like to look at investing in companies
> that are undergoing change - like a new CEO
> at the helm.
> I have had a lot of success finding a
> company that was vastly underdeveloped, and
> in need of leadership change. By following
> company movement closely you can predict
> upcoming management changes.
> In underdeveloped investment opportunities,
> often a change in leadership (not always at
> the top level) can create growth and
> investor confidence - driving up prices.
